UPDATE:
Just came back from the shop, turns out it IS the driver side axle.
The oil that I notice is actually from the power steering, the cold weather here froze and cracked something...
We ordered a GS-R axle, but for some reason, it doesn't fit? I was told that 6th Gen Si B16 axles don't fit so I went ahead with the B18C, but the end where it meets the transmission (intermediate) the end on the GS-R is 'female' whereas on the B16, it's a male? I researched all over and I could have swore the GS-R is a direct fit, perhaps they sent us the wrong shaft. So for the time being, we packed in grease and re-assembled the old shaft and it works fine, for now.
Thanks for the help everyone!